Mobile Application Costs 2025 - Business Guide
UP2DATE Team
Software Development
In today's digital age, mobile presence is no longer optional for business – it's essential. But how much does it really cost to develop a mobile app in 2025? At UP2DATE, with over 15 years of experience developing applications for companies in Romania and Europe, we offer you a transparent and detailed guide on the investment required to turn your idea into a successful application.
Why do mobile app costs vary so much?
The first question we get from customers is invariably, "How much does an app cost me?" The answer is not simple, because developing a mobile app is like building a house – the price depends on the size, complexity, finishes and location.
Main factors influencing the cost:
1. Application Complexity
- 📱 Simple apps (5-10 screens, basic functionalities): 10,000 - 25,000 EUR
- 📊 Medium apps (15-25 screens, API integrations, authentication): 25,000 - 60,000 EUR
- 🚀 Complex Apps (30+ screens, advanced features, complex backend): 60,000 - 150,000+ EUR
2. Target platforms
- iOS or Android (native): base cost
- Both platforms (native): +70-80% of base cost
- Cross-platform (React Native, Flutter): 30-40% savings compared to dual native development
3. Design and user experience (UX/UI)
- Standard design with templates: 2,000 - 5,000 EUR
- Medium custom design: 5,000 - 15,000 EUR
- Premium design with complex animations: 15,000 - 30,000+ EUR
Application types and estimated costs for 2025
1. Presentation/Information Applications
Features: Static content, company information, product catalog Estimated cost: 8,000 - 20,000 EUR Development time: 4-8 weeks Examples: Presentation applications for restaurants, salons, clinics
2. E-commerce applications
Features: Product catalog, shopping cart, online payments, notifications Estimated cost: 25,000 - 70,000 EUR Development time: 3-6 months Examples: Online stores, marketplaces, delivery apps
3. Social and communication applications
Features: User profiles, chat, content sharing, news feed Estimated cost: 40,000 - 120,000 EUR Development time: 4-8 months Examples: Niche social networks, dating platforms, professional networking apps
4. On-demand and marketplace applications
Features: Geo-location, algorithmic matching, payments, rating and review Estimated cost: 50,000 - 150,000 EUR Development time: 6-12 months Examples: Uber-type applications, service platforms, B2B marketplaces
5. Enterprise and B2B applications
Features: Complex integrations, advanced security, reporting, workflows Estimated cost: 70,000 - 250,000+ EUR Development time: 6-18 months Examples: Mobile CRM, management applications, automation platforms
The hidden costs of mobile app development
Many entrepreneurs focus only on the initial cost of development, but there are important additional costs to consider:
1. Post-launch costs (annual)
- Maintenance and Updates: 15-20% of initial development cost
- Hosting and infrastructure: 200-2,000 EUR/month (depending on traffic)
- Third-party licenses: 100-1,000 EUR/month
- Certification and publishing: 100 EUR/year (App Store) + 25 EUR (Google Play)
2. Marketing and User Acquisition
- ASO (App Store Optimization): 500-2,000 EUR/month
- Promotion campaigns: 2,000-10,000 EUR/month
- Content marketing: 1,000-5,000 EUR/month
3. Compliance and Security
- Security Audit: EUR 3,000-10,000
- GDPR compliance: EUR 2,000-5,000
- Industry-specific certifications: EUR 5,000-20,000
How to save money without compromising on quality
1. Start with an MVP (Minimum Viable Product)
Instead of releasing a full app from scratch, develop core functionality first. This allows you to:
- Test the idea with minimal costs (40-60% savings)
- Get real feedback from users
- Prioritize features based on real data
2. Choose the right technology
- React Native or Flutter for cross-platform applications (30-40% savings)
- Progressive Web Apps (PWA) for simple functionalities (50-70% savings)
- Native development only when performance is critical
3. Use existing components and services
- Integrations with cloud services (Firebase, AWS): 20-30% savings on the backend
- UI kits and predefined components: 15-25% design savings
- Third-party APIs for complex functionalities: saving time and money
4. Outsource Smartly
- Teams from Romania: Western European quality at 60-70% of the cost
- Hybrid collaboration model: internal team + outsourcing
- Long-term maintenance contracts: 10-20% discounts
Pricing models in the industry
1. Fixed price
Advantages: Clear budget, no surprises Cons: Limited flexibility, higher cost Recommended for: Projects with clear and well-defined requirements
2. Time & Materials
Advantages: Maximum flexibility, pay only for what you use Cons: Less predictable budget Recommended for: Innovative projects, MVPs, iterative development
3. Dedicated team
Advantages: Total control, scalability, optimized long-term cost Cons: Requires active management Recommended for: Long-term projects, complex products Average cost in Romania: 3,000-6,000 EUR/developer/month
The ROI of a mobile app: Is it worth the investment?
A well-developed mobile app can generate 200-500% ROI in the first 2-3 years by:
- Increase sales: Mobile users buy 2.3x more
- Operational cost reduction: Automation and increased efficiency
- Customer loyalty: 3x higher retention rate
- Competitive advantage: 67% of consumers prefer brands with mobile apps
Signs You're Paying Too Much for Your App
⚠️ Watch out for these signals:
- Offers under EUR 5,000 for "complete" applications
- Development promises in less than 4 weeks
- Lack of a relevant portfolio
- No clear contract and delivery stages
- 100% advance payment requirements
Development process and cost impact
Phase 1: Discovery and Planning (5-10% of budget)
- Requirements analysis
- Market research
- Technical architecture
- Duration: 1-2 weeks
Phase 2: UX/UI Design (15-25% of budget)
- Wireframes and prototypes
- Visual design
- Usability tests
- Duration: 2-4 weeks
Phase 3: Development (40-60% of budget)
- Frontend and backend programming
- API integrations
- Functionality implementation
- Duration: 8-24 weeks
Phase 4: Testing and QA (10-15% of budget)
- Functional tests
- Performance tests
- Debugging
- Duration: 2-4 weeks
Phase 5: Launch and deployment (5-10% of the budget)
- Publication in stores
- Server configuration
- Initial monitoring
- Duration: 1-2 weeks
Technologies and cost impact in 2025
Native development
iOS (Swift):
- Developer cost: 40-80 EUR/hour
- Advantages: Maximum performance, full access to functionalities
- When to choose: Graphics intensive applications, games, AR/VR
Android (Kotlin):
- Developer cost: 35-75 EUR/hour
- Advantages: Flexibility, large market
- When to choose: Mass-market applications
Cross-platform development
React Native:
- Developer cost: 35-70 EUR/hour
- Economy: 30-40% compared to double native development
- Ideal for: Business, e-commerce, social applications
Flutter:
- Developer cost: 30-65 EUR/hour
- Economy: 35-45% compared to double native development
- Ideal for: MVPs, apps with complex design
Case studies: Real costs from UP2DATE projects
Case 1: Local delivery application
- Budget: EUR 35,000
- Duration: 4 months
- Technology: React Native
- Results: 10,000+ downloads in first month, ROI in 8 months
Case 2: B2B platform for the construction industry
- Budget: EUR 85,000
- Duration: 7 months
- Technology: Flutter + Node.js backend
- Results: Reduction of operational costs by 40%
Case 3: Fitness app with AI
- Budget: EUR 120,000
- Duration: 10 months
- Technology: Native iOS + Native Android + ML Kit
- Results: 50,000+ active users, 4.8 star rating
How to choose the right development partner
What to look for:
✅ Proven Experience in your industry. ✅ Relevant portfolio with similar apps ✅ Transparent development process ✅ Clear and regular communication ✅ Post-release support guaranteed ✅ Verifiable references from previous clients
Essential questions to ask:
- What is your experience with similar apps?
- What technologies do you recommend and why?
- How do you manage requirements changes?
- What does the exact price include?
- What are the maintenance costs?
- How do you ensure data security?
- What guarantees do you offer?
2025 trends that influence costs
1. Artificial Intelligence and Machine Learning
- Cost increase: +20-40% for AI functionalities
- Potential ROI: 3-5x higher
- Applications: Personalization, automation, predictive analytics
2. 5G and Edge Computing
- Impact: More complex and faster applications
- Additional cost: 10-20% for optimization
- Benefits: Superior user experience
3. Super Apps and Mini Programs
- Trend: All-in-one applications
- Cost: +30-50% compared to simple applications
- Advantage: Complete ecosystem for users
Conclusion: Smart investment in mobile app
The cost of a mobile app in 2025 ranges from €10,000 to €250,000+, depending on complexity, functionality and quality. The key to success is not finding the cheapest option, but investing smart in:
- Thorough planning to avoid unexpected costs
- The right technology for your specific needs
- The right partner with proven experience
- MVP approach for rapid validation
- Post-launch budget and marketing
Why UP2DATE?
At UP2DATE, we offer total transparency in pricing and process. With over 200+ apps delivered and a 98% satisfaction rate, we are the ideal partner for your business digital transformation.
📱 Request a free consultation to discuss your project and receive a personalized cost estimate.
💡 Pro Tip: Most of our customers recover their app investment in less than 12 months through increased efficiency and sales.
This article was updated in February 2025 to reflect the latest market trends and prices. For an accurate estimate tailored to your needs, contact the UP2DATE team.